Description
The NI-9242 is a C Series Analog Input module with a part number of 783107-01. It is designed for precision measurements with a 24-Bit resolution across its 3-Channel configuration. This module can be configured for either single-phase or three-phase (WYE and Delta) applications, providing versatility for various electrical measurement tasks.
It is compatible with the National Instruments LabVIEW Electrical Power Suite, offering seamless integration for users working within the LabVIEW environment. To ensure accuracy and reliability, calibration is recommended annually. The NI-9242 can handle signal levels up to 250 Vrms L-N and 400 Vrms L-L, making it suitable for a wide range of electrical measurements. With a sampling rate of 50 kS/s per channel, this module can accurately capture fast-changing signals.
The module adheres to several safety and reliability standards, including C37.90, IEC 61010-1, C37.60, and IEC 60255-1. Each channel features an independent ADC and signal path, ensuring isolated and precise measurements. Both digital and analog filters are employed to reduce noise and improve signal quality.
Connection to the module is made easy with a screw terminal front connector. It operates within a temperature range of -40 °C to 70 °C and has a low power consumption of 332 mW (max) when active and up to 50 µW in sleep mode. Weighing only 5.3 oz, it is lightweight yet robust for various industrial applications.
